About UsBarkers is an award-winning mid-market and corporate market implementation partner for Coupa and our practice is growing rapidly as we deliver first class solutions across a range of clients. As a result, we are now looking to recruit an experienced Solutions Architect to join our fantastic permanent team. As an experienced professional with more than 4 years experience in delivering P2P solutions, this role will provide you with the support, training and experience to rapidly develop your career both as a technical expert and as a consultant.Job PurposeThe Solutions Architect will lead the design, implementation, and management of technical solutions, ensuring seamless integration and optimal performance. This role supports clients in enhancing their technology capabilities through strategic planning, solution development, and deployment, while collaborating closely with stakeholders to understand business needs, provide tailored recommendations, and foster strong relationships to deliver successful outcomes. This role requires exceptional communication skills, deep knowledge of Coupa, and high degree of self-accountability operating within a multi-client environment.ResponsibilitiesAct as the leading authority on the functional and technical deployment of Coupa for clients.Handle all aspects of technical and functional design, configuration, and deployment of the platform into client environments, ensuring seamless integration and optimal performance.Contribute to the end-to-end client lifecycle, from initial proposals through implementation, project management, and platform embedding.Bring expertise in all implementation components, including Coupa configuration, setup, and supplier enablement.Conduct workshops and design review sessions to maintain alignment between clients and project plans.Work confidently in a multi-client environment, adhering to time-bound project plans.Provide technical and functional guidance to clients during implementation to ensure successful adoption.Create and refine implementation templates, training materials, and presentations to promote knowledge sharing and best practices.Apply implementation methodologies and industry knowledge to develop effective functional designs.Share relevant experiences with clients and colleagues to encourage collaboration and continuous improvement.Mentor and train team members on technical design, implementation, and best practices.Support the creation and presentation of sales proposals to prospective clients.Line management of staff as required, whether in project lifecycle or an ongoing basis.We embrace opportunities for growth and development through training and personal development activities, staying ahead of the curve in your role.
